I was just wondering if it was possible to make a compatibility patch for SOS to work with the lastest version of Better Vampires?  I think SOS may interfere with its scripts or something, because when I have SOS installed at the same time as BV I am unable to get all of the spells.  Thanks in advance! 

 

I've been using BV and SOS together without any issues for quite a long time.  I see the SOS spells and all BV spells available depending on your vampire level.  You didn't specify which spells were missing:  the SOS erection spells (which aren't needed anyway when using with SexLab) or the vampire spells provided by BV.  Remember also that the some of the BV spells don't appear until after your first bite (Vampire Natus - very first level) and other vamp spells only appear when obtaining the other BV vampire levels.

 

 

I don't get absolutely ANY of the BV spells when I have SOS activated.  One of the first spells you get is Vampire DraIn.  That never shows up, and neither do any of the others.  Other aspects of the mod work, I can drink blood, extract blood potions from my victims if I have the settings for that selected, I can even achieve the first vampire level.  I just CAN'T get the spells, which for me is the best part of the mod, especially the ability to make other vampires.  I wish I could get my install to work with SOS and BV together as you seem to.  :(  Oddly I CAN get them to work together IF I become a vampire BEFORE I have SOS activated.  Then I can activate SOS and everything works as it should, its weird.  But if I want to start a fresh new game I have to disable SOS first, start my new game, become a vampire and then reenable it. I wish I didn't have to go through that to make them work together.

If that's the only mod it's crashing on, try redownloading SOS.  I just installed latest SOS with latest NMM and had no issues at all.  If you are having problems installing other mods, then maybe NMM needs a reinstall, or time to switch to MO if you want.

 

 

 

...and it is very important to swap NMM for Mod Organizer...

 

If the SOS download was bad, then switching to MO is useless (the problem will still occur with it).  Telling people to switch to MO without knowing the actual cause of the problem is useless, and since I installed SOS using NMM with no problem, it is not an NMM general issue.  I do suggest people use MO if they feel more comfortable with it, but it is not necessary to make mods work in Skyrim.
